Cisco to develop 6.6 lakh sq ft more space in Bangalore

Posted on 30 July 2009





BANGALORE: This comes as a downpour in Bangalore’s realty drought. Multinational networking giant Cisco has cleared the deck for developing an additional 6.6 lakh sq ft office space with a provision of scaling it up to 2.2 million sq ft in Bangalore, making this the largest development plan by an IT major in recent times. More than the realty expansion, the move perhaps signals the fact that the IT industry may be readying to invest on future growth, according to a realty consultant who works closely with many IT companies.

Cisco currently occupies 1.2 million sq ft at Cessna Business Park, an operating SEZ developed by Bangalore-based Prestige Group and has a staff strength of around 4,000. The 6.6 lakh sq.ft facility is targeted to be completed by the second quarter of 2012. Once that happens, Cisco will be occupying 1.8 million sq ft, making the India centre its largest outside of the US. In the long term, Cisco’s India centre could even touch 3.2 million sq ft. Subash Rao, director-HR , Cisco India , says, “Cisco has designated Bangalore as our globalisation centre East and indicated that we will have 10,000-12 ,000 employees based here over the next three to five years. The idea is for 20% of the top talent in Cisco to be based here.”
